【Best Value Ryzen Mini PC】GMKtec Nucbox M6 Series is equipped with the powerful AMD R5 6600H processor, 6 Cores/12 Threads, Boost up to 4.50GHz, Based on the ZEN 3+ architecture, preinstalled with Windows 11 pro, this small but powerful mini pc delivers satisfying results in productivity, office work, and gaming. It uses the new upgraded iGPU AMD Radeon 660M which is an upgrade over the previous AMD RX Vega 8. With a TDP Boost of 45W, the Ryzen 6600H CPU delivers a 30% Performance increase over previous AMD Ryzen 7 5700U, Ryzen 5 5600U 5560U 5500U.
【DUAL NIC LAN 2.5G RJ45】Fast Network Speeds: Enjoy up to 2500Mbps data transmission speed without worrying about lagging. Ideal for working, gaming, and surfing the internet. Great for Untangle, Pfsense or as a server office PC
【16GB DDR5 RAM & 512GB PCIe SSD】Installed with DDR5 16GB RAM Dual Channel (2x8GB), the M6 mini pc support expansion to 64GB RAM. Featured with 512GB M.2 2280 PCIe 3.0 SSD, support dual slot expansion to PCIe 4.0 4TB SSD. (Upgrades not included)
【Mini Desktop Computer with 4K Triple Screen Display】Nucbox M6 integrates AMD Radeon 660M 6 Cores 1900 MHz GPU to deliver powerful graphics processing power to easily handle the demands of complex design software, 4K@60Hz UHD video editing, and playback, or mid-range gaming. And it can connect to 3 display screens simultaneously
【Fast Internet WiFi 6E + BT5.2 Connection】GMKtec Mini PC Ryzen 6600H with WiFi-6E Wireless, have 2.5G/5G/6G triple band, more faster and lower latency. Bluetooth 5.2 allowing you more quickly to connect other wireless devices (headset, mouse, keyboard, etc.) Interface features 2*USB3.2 ports, 2*USB2.0 ports, 1*HDMI 2.0 port(4K@60Hz), 1*USB 4.0 port(PD/DP/DATA), 1*DP Port, 1*Audio 3.5mm (HP&MIC), 1*DC Power Port

Excellent small capable device
Purchased as a Linux media PC and NAS.Running Debian. I have not been able to get WiFi 6E to work with 6ghz signal. On 5ghz, wifi works pretty well with good speed. However the WiFi card’s temperature can quickly skyrocket to absurdly high destructive temperatures. If you max out the WiFi link such as during a local speed test, I’ve seen the temperature quickly climb above 105 C before I chickened out and stopped the speed test.Otherwise the system is most impressive in that it can run cool especially in its low power mode set via EUFI.There’s a secondary fan on top. It’s quite noisy. Runs all the time and does very little to cool the device. Monitoring temperatures, the fan does not significantly help cool the WiFi adapter. SSD doesn’t seem to heat up much even without the fan. This MiniPC had been sold earlier without the top fan. Not sure why they felt the need to add one. I had earlier tried the GMKTec G3 minipc. Its SSD did get extremely hot and it doesn’t have a fan, no heatsink, and the SSD is in a sealed top area without ventilation. Maybe they’re overcompensating in this minipc or maybe it depends on the specific brand SSD included.As a media PC, the GPU is plenty fast to play 4k60 video stream even on low power mode. Meets my use case.It’s also ideal for my use case as a NAS to have the two 2.5gbs ethernet ports. Pretty easy to set up bridging in Debian between the two ports. Can get amazing speeds to/from the NAS over 2.5gb ethernet.Overall, good system, good value when promotion or coupon is in place.

I wasn’t sure but I am now.
I bought this as a small secondary machine that I was hoping I might be able to run one particular game that has issues on my main system. I love tiny machines and normally buy refurbished Lenovo Tiny systems but I already know their graphics would not be remotely up to the task. So, I took a shot and purchased this one after reading loads of the reviews. For reference the game I wanted to run is 7 Days to Die.Well, the setup took no time at all. Windows 11 was activated, I ran updates and finally downloaded the game. The networking was great (ethernet) and the game downloaded in record time (speedtest is showing 980 on my gig connection). Now to see if it works. Is it up to my main gaming system? No but the other system has an RTX 2060 so the graphics comparison isn’t truly fair. Running with everything set to high it runs a dismal 12 fps. I turned down a number of the high impact settings and got ti up to 26 fps which is surprising playable. So, is it a great gaming system? Probably not, but does it do what I needed it for? Absolutely.I would say if you are looking for low end gaming it might work well for you. If you are looking for a relatively inexpensive, but very nice general use system this is great. I have no idea what the life span will be for it as I’ve only had it about 1 month but so far I am pretty happy with the purchase. Now if you will excuse me I am off to kill some zombies.
